为Claude Code配置自定义模型服务,连接Taotoken聚合端点的详细步骤
1. 准备工作
在开始配置之前,请确保您已经拥有一个有效的Taotoken账户,并在控制台中创建了API Key。同时,您需要在模型广场查看并记录下您希望使用的模型ID。这些信息将在后续步骤中使用。
2. 配置环境变量
Claude Code支持通过环境变量来配置自定义的Anthropic兼容服务端点。这是最推荐的配置方式,因为它可以全局生效且不会影响其他工具的配置。
对于Linux/macOS用户,可以在终端中执行以下命令:
export ANTHROPIC_BASE_URL="https://taotoken.net/api" export ANTHROPIC_AUTH_TOKEN="YOUR_API_KEY" export ANTHROPIC_MODEL="YOUR_MODEL_ID"对于Windows用户,可以在PowerShell中执行:
$env:ANTHROPIC_BASE_URL="https://taotoken.net/api" $env:ANTHROPIC_AUTH_TOKEN="YOUR_API_KEY" $env:ANTHROPIC_MODEL="YOUR_MODEL_ID"请将YOUR_API_KEY和YOUR_MODEL_ID替换为您实际的API Key和模型ID。
3. 修改配置文件
如果您希望配置持久化,可以直接修改Claude Code的配置文件。配置文件的位置根据操作系统不同而有所差异:
- Linux/macOS:
~/.claude/settings.json - Windows:
%USERPROFILE%\.claude\settings.json
打开配置文件后,添加或修改以下内容:
{ "env": { "ANTHROPIC_BASE_URL": "https://taotoken.net/api", "ANTHROPIC_AUTH_TOKEN": "YOUR_API_KEY", "ANTHROPIC_MODEL": "YOUR_MODEL_ID" } }同样,请替换其中的占位符为您的实际信息。
4. 验证配置
配置完成后,您可以通过以下方式验证配置是否生效:
- 启动Claude Code
- 执行一个简单的查询
- 检查返回结果是否符合预期
如果遇到任何问题,可以检查Claude Code的日志输出,通常会包含详细的错误信息。
5. 使用Taotoken CLI工具简化配置
Taotoken提供了一个命令行工具来简化配置过程。如果您已经安装了Node.js环境,可以通过以下命令使用:
npx @taotoken/taotoken cc -k YOUR_API_KEY -u https://taotoken.net/api -m YOUR_MODEL_ID这个命令会自动帮您完成上述所有配置步骤。工具会检测您的操作系统类型,并将配置写入正确的位置。
6. 常见问题与注意事项
- 确保Base URL设置为
https://taotoken.net/api,不要添加/v1后缀 - 如果同时使用多个Anthropic兼容工具,注意环境变量可能会被覆盖
- 定期检查API Key的剩余配额,避免因额度耗尽导致服务不可用
- 模型ID区分大小写,请确保与模型广场中显示的完全一致
完成以上步骤后,您的Claude Code就已经成功连接到Taotoken的聚合端点,可以开始使用统一接口调用多种大模型服务了。如需了解更多功能,可以访问Taotoken官方站点。